Change of Service or Service upgrade
What is a “Change of Service” fee?
A “change of service” fee would be charged under the following conditions;
-
Customer chooses to convert from overhead service to underground service.
-
Customer changes out an existing outdoor panel, either keeping it the same size, or increasing the amperage, that requires the meter to be pulled or service to be disconnected to perform the work in a safe manner.
Panels sub-feeding from a main panel will not be included in “Change of service” fees. Replacement of breakers or conductors of the same size will not be included in “Change of Service” fees.
“Service Request” forms will be filled out for all “Change of Service” requests. The City of Leesburg building department will not issue permits for electrical work that falls under the above categories without a “service request” form.
All services shall have a main disconnect on the outside of the house or building for safety reasons.
If you plan on upgrading your electric service, call a Service Planner at 352-728-9786, extensions 2020, 2021 or 2026, or email at Electric Service Planners, prior to starting any work. They will meet you onsite to determine if any additional work may be required. The Service Planner will complete a “Service Request” form which will be needed at Customer Service to pay all applicable fees. The form must also be presented at the City of Leesburg Building Department to obtain a permit.
After all fees are paid, and permits are secured, the customer can call our Dispatchers at 352-728-9830 to schedule disconnect/reconnects for an Electric Service upgrade. Please call a minimum of 72 hours ahead of time to get placed on the schedule.
